rbsiedsc 2,059 Posted December 7, 2020 Author Share Posted December 7, 2020 I have recently found my sweet spot of a weak right hand and neutral left. I need this kind of set up, otherwise I close the clubface too shut causing pulls and hooks. So far so good. I do make my right hand progressively weaker as I get to my lower lofted clubs, along with making sure the face is more open at address. Quote Driver: Epic Flash SZ with Pro 2.0 TS 7X. RI_Redneck 127 Posted December 9, 2020 Share Posted December 9, 2020 (edited) Early on I sliced the ball like many do. I fought this by trying to train my hands to roll through impact. After decades of inconsistency, I decided that I would progressively make my grip stronger until I didn't have to do anything with my hands when swinging. Now, I just take my grip based on the shot I plan to hit (fade, straight or draw) and swing the club. Happy to say that my consistency is tons better and I am now playing some of the best golf of my life. Experiment to find what works.
